We are currently hiring fresh graduates for Entry Level Laboratory Assistant. These candidates support the laboratory team by assisting with the collection and preparation of samples from mining operations.
This role involves following instructions accurately, learning new procedures quickly, and ensuring that samples are handled and prepared correctly for analysis.
The ideal candidate will be eager to be trained, learn, detail-oriented, and capable of following orders effectively.
Key Responsibilities
Collect samples from various sources, including ore, crushed stone, and workshop production materials, as directed by senior staff.
Prepare samples for analysis by following established procedures, including drying, grinding, and labeling.
Ensure samples are handled properly and in accordance with laboratory protocols.
Assist with routine laboratory tasks, such as measuring, mixing, and basic testing under the supervision of experienced staff.
Maintain a clean and organized laboratory environment by following safety and cleanliness procedures.
Support the setup and calibration of laboratory equipment as needed.
Quickly learn and adapt to new procedures and techniques as instructed by senior laboratory personnel.
Follow orders and guidelines precisely to ensure consistency and accuracy in laboratory work.
Participate in training sessions and seek to improve skills and knowledge relevant to the role.
